六步打造计算机网络安全:防火墙设置教程

需积分: 8 9 下载量 98 浏览量 更新于2024-08-14 收藏 9.79MB PPT 举报
创建防火墙的步骤是确保计算机网络安全的关键环节。以下是一个详细的六步骤指南: 1. **制定安全策略**:首先,你需要明确网络的安全目标和需求,确定防火墙应抵御哪些威胁,以及如何保护关键信息。这包括确定安全政策、访问控制规则以及风险评估。 2. **搭建安全体系结构**:根据制定的安全策略,设计防火墙的物理和逻辑架构,可能涉及选择硬件防火墙、软件防火墙、下一代防火墙(NGFW)或分布式防火墙等。同时要考虑网络拓扑和冗余设计,以保证系统的稳定性。 3. **制定规则次序**:防火墙规则集应按照优先级和策略进行排序,确保高优先级规则先执行,如阻止恶意流量、允许特定服务和流量等。这涉及到入站和出站规则的配置。 4. **落实规则集**:将策略转化为具体操作,配置防火墙软件或硬件,设置访问控制列表(ACL)、端口转发、安全组等,确保只有授权的流量可以通过。 5. **注意更换控制**:随着网络环境的变化,如新设备接入、业务扩展或威胁演进,定期审查和更新防火墙规则至关重要。这包括更新病毒库、黑名单和白名单,以应对新的威胁。 6. **审计工作**:实施严格的审计机制,监控防火墙的运行状况,记录所有进出网络的数据包,以便于追踪异常行为和进行安全事件响应。审计报告可以帮助你评估防火墙的有效性,并作为改进措施的依据。 在整个过程中,对计算机网络基础知识的理解至关重要,比如了解OSI七层网络模型和TCP/IP协议族,知道如何配置网络服务和管理端口。此外,编程能力,尤其是对C/C++和Socket编程的掌握,能帮助你更好地定制和实现防火墙功能。 网络安全编程基础包括操作系统编程、网络安全协议理解和实现,如使用加密算法保护信息机密性,利用消息摘要确保信息完整性。理解信息安全层次结构,如密码学、安全协议、网络安全和应用安全,以及信息安全的基本要求,如CIA(机密性、完整性、可用性)原则,都是创建有效防火墙不可或缺的部分。 通过深入理解这些概念并结合实践经验,你可以成功创建出一个强大的防火墙系统,确保你的网络环境得到有效的保护。